Title: Naoki Kakuta: A Pioneer in Connector Terminal Innovations

Introduction

Naoki Kakuta, an accomplished inventor based in Makinohara, Japan, has made significant contributions to the field of electrical connectors. With a total of nine patents to his name, his work reflects a deep understanding of the intricacies of connection technology and electrical conductivity.

Latest Patents

Kakuta's most recent patents include innovative designs that enhance the mechanical and electrical performance of connector terminals. His first notable patent focuses on a connector terminal that achieves high mechanical connection strength and stabilized low electrical connection resistance when crimped to an aluminum electric wire. This innovative design effectively suppresses electrical contact resistance when fitted to a mating connector terminal. The patent details a structure where a base material of aluminum or an aluminum alloy is overlaid with layers of zinc, copper, and tin, each carefully calibrated in thickness to maximize performance.

Additionally, another of his latest patents introduces a terminal fitting capable of reliably press-bonding core wires made of aluminum or aluminum alloys. This design features a copper or copper alloy base with unique crimping pieces that improve the integrity of the connection, ensuring a high-performance interaction with the wires.

Career Highlights

Kakuta has been associated with prominent companies such as Yazaki Corporation and Kabushiki Kaisha Kobe Seiko Sho, where he has honed his skills and developed his innovative ideas. His career reflects a commitment to advancing technology in the electrical industry, particularly in enhancing connection quality and durability.

Collaborations

Throughout his career, Naoki has collaborated with talented individuals such as Nobuaki Yoshioka and Satoshi Yagi. Their combined expertise has contributed to the successful development of pioneering technologies in electrical connectors, enhancing the industry standards.
